“Marginal Risk” for Severe Weather Across the Area on Thursday

Thursday severe weather outlook

Residents across East Alabama should keep an eye out for strong thunderstorms as the day goes on.

According to the National Weather Service there’s a marginal risk for severe weather as a cold front moves through our area, and across the state (Thursday).  Forecasters say there is a low risk for a few damaging wind gusts – the cities of Ft Payne, Gadsden and Anniston are also specifically mentioned in that marginal risk area.
